Mood and Risk-Taking as Momentum for Creativity
1Graduate School of Business Administration, Kobe University, Kobe, Japan.
This study found that risk-taking positively impacts divergent thinking, especially with negative rewards, while mood did not significantly affect creative thinking types. A Q-learning model was used to analyze these effects.

Background:
- Understanding the interplay of internal states and decision-making is crucial for creativity.
- Existing research often examines mood or risk-taking in isolation, with limited computational approaches.
- The representational change theory offers a framework for understanding insight and potentially broader creative processes.
Purpose of the Study:
- To investigate the independent and combined effects of mood and risk-taking on divergent and convergent thinking.
- To apply a Q-learning computational model to quantify the influence of these factors on creative processes.
- To explore the relevance of representational change theory to creative thinking.
Main Methods:
- Utilized a Q-learning computational model to simulate decision-making under varying mood and risk-taking conditions.
- Empirically assessed divergent and convergent thinking performance.
- Analyzed the model's parameters to distinguish the roles of mood and risk-taking in updating values and decision-making.
Main Results:
- Mood did not show a significant direct relationship with either divergent or convergent thinking.
- Risk-taking positively influenced divergent thinking, particularly when associated with negative rewards.
- The findings align with the principles of representational change theory, suggesting its applicability to creative thinking.
Conclusions:
- Risk-taking is a significant factor in enhancing divergent thinking, especially in challenging reward scenarios.
- Mood's direct impact on creative thinking types may be less pronounced than previously assumed.
- The computational Q-learning model provides novel insights into the distinct roles of psychological factors in creativity.
